tsoutliers依赖问题:依赖关系KFKSDS的退出状态是否为非零?

时间:2017-11-05 07:16:54

标签: r ubuntu time-series outliers

在对时间序列数据进行异常值检测时。我遇到了实现Chen and Liu's time series异常值检测的[tsoutliers][1]个包。但是我无法在R

中安装tsoutliers
  

install.packages(" tsoutliers&#34)

我收到以下依赖项错误

  

KF-deriv.cpp中包含的文件:1:0:KFKSDS.h:14:28:致命错误:   gsl / gsl_vector.h:没有终止此类文件或目录编译。   / usr / lib / R / etc / Makeconf:143:目标配方' KF-deriv.o'失败   make:*** [KF-deriv.o]错误1错误:包的编译失败   “KFKSDS”   *删除'/home/atoffy/R/x86_64-pc-linux-gnu-library/3.2/KFKSDS'警告install.packages:安装包'KFKSDS'有   非零退出状态错误:依赖性'KF​​KSDS'不可用   包'stsm'   *删除'/home/atoffy/R/x86_64-pc-linux-gnu-library/3.2/stsm'警告在install.packages中:安装包'stsm'了   非零退出状态错误:依赖性'stsm','KFKSDS'不是   可用于包装'tsoutliers'   *删除'/home/atoffy/R/x86_64-pc-linux-gnu-library/3.2/tsoutliers'警告install.packages:安装包'tsoutliers'   具有非零退出状态

更具体地说

  

目标配方' KF-deriv.o'失败

有人可以帮我安装吗?

1 个答案:

答案 0 :(得分:5)

我能够通过安装

来解决这个问题
  

libgsl0

sudo apt-get install libgsl0-dev